Interleukin-9 (IL-9) is a pleiotropic cytokine belonging to the common gamma-chain (γc) family, primarily produced by Th9 cells, but also by Th2, Th17, and regulatory T cells. Traditionally, IL-9 signaling was understood to occur through a heterodimeric receptor complex consisting of the IL-9 receptor alpha (IL-9Rα) and the common gamma chain (γc), primarily in hematopoietic cells. However, recent research has identified a novel "type II" IL-9 receptor complex in airway epithelial cells, composed of IL-9Rα and the IL-13 receptor alpha 1 (IL-13Rα1) subunit. This signaling pathway activates STAT3 and induces the expression of chemokines such as CXCL3, which promotes the recruitment of CXCR2+ immune cells and contributes to airway inflammation and asthma pathogenesis. While IL-9 is a target for antagonistic therapies in respiratory disease, recombinant IL-9 is also investigated in preclinical oncology for its potential to stimulate mast cells and enhance anti-tumor immunity.
